This to me is an example of how NOT to think about FA. Furrey is a guy who owes everything to Martz for moving him back to WR and putting him in a position to be successful. That's the kind of guy who very rarely leaves his current team.

Plus you are violating several principle of FA - a) don't pay a guy after 1 good year and b) don't expect #3 WRs to become #2 or #2s to become #1s (as you want to do with Crayton).
